Output 0341352081510633519a808e545751f56f6a57596c46550199655084f3767435:45

value
11377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c863f4b32dcefbdf1791b03f11b0e1bb1418b28 OP_EQUAL
address
3LLSbLcf4j1jx7RxuHYQaAHJEaTD2W3V2T
transaction
0341352081510633519a808e545751f56f6a57596c46550199655084f3767435
spent
true